New BSSP website images

Each year we invite two Photography students from Filton College in Bristol to create header images for our website. This year's images have been created by Jess Stephens and Tom Farrant whose commitment and enthusiasm for the project was really refreshing. We are very grateful to them and, also, to course leader Nick Bright for his very valuable support and input with this initiative.

Jess Stephens is a photographer from Thornbury, near Bristol, currently working towards a BA at UWE. Her passions as a photographer lie within the natural world with its energy and magic, wildness and spirit. She enjoys experimenting with her work- using pinhole and various darkroom techniques. She is fascinated by time and movement, and finds photography unique in its ability to record periods of time and motion in one image. Jess, also, has a strong interest in events and portrait photography.

Tom Farrant is a photgrapher/artist/designer based in central Bristol, currently studying and pursuing various projects. At the moment, after creating 'Left', a book of abstract night photography around central Bristol, he is experimenting with working at night with 5x4 large format, aiming to exhibit in the near future. Tom is also interested in photographing alternative fashion and alternative music, and is open to commission.
